Cleaning a room is made up of a hundred little

tasks- and sometimes there isn't time for a hundred things. Especially if you're a mom. You never know when your help or presence will be immediately required!

But what if there was a way to start cleaning by doing the very minimum?

I want to share a little tip that if adapted into a habit becomes a real game changer in your home, and its very simple and I'm sure we have all heard it a million times...


"leave a place better than when you found it"


As someone who steps over messes a little too easily at times, this helps me immensely.

how many times do you walk in a room and see all the little things that need to get done or picked up?

and how many times do you walk out of said room leaving it exactly as you found it, because you "don't have time to clean that."



but more often than not, I think we do have the time, but it just seems like it will take too much time. I am speaking from personal experience.

But never mind our own messes we can make, like I said if we have children, there are bound to be little messes all around, as I type this I am looking at a princess peach wrist band laying on my bedroom floor. How did it get there? I am not sure, but it has the makings of a 3-year-old all over it. haha.


So back to this really helpful tip...

"Leave a place better than you found it"


that's it.

It can be as simple as picking up 1 piece of trash that's been eyeing you all week,

because guess what?

the next time you go into your room, you won't see it and you will most likely feel better! 


it's definitely something that will take practice to remember, but as they say 21 days make a habit so why not start today!


Make it your goal for the next 21 days, to make a room better than when you first walked in..

see a dirty dish? grab it on the way out of your room and put it in the sink.

see some toys lying around? pick them up and put them in the toy area.

some dirty clothes on the floor? put them in the hamper on your way to the bathroom!


You don't need to go out of your way to do them, you just do them as you're on your way out!
